[Challenge Only] Digitization of manufacturing documentation

Monitor and improve the efficiency of production processes.

Challenge:

The company employs around 4,000 people on various workstations. The described challenge concerns one of the company’s departments. This department has a total of five machines: four CNC machines and one manual machine. Each of them performs different operations.
The challenge for the company will be to eliminate paper technologies and paper guides kept in the workplace, on which each employee confirms the operation with a stamp. For this, we need a system that, after reading the QR code placed on each product, will open technologies and information such as, for example, the dimensions of the part after the previous operation. Each employee, thanks to specially assigned password-protected permissions, could enter the parameters he has performed and comments on a given element, which would also improve the work of the technological section, which, thanks to the analysis of operators’ comments, could streamline the process. The system would also help the management team to monitor the progress of production as well as problems that occur in production. This system would be a big step for our company towards ecological solutions, because it would eliminate the paper that would be needed to print technology and production guides.
